The system's iconic feature for which it is named is its autostereoscopic top screen, fire emblem games on 3ds, which projects an illusion of 3D depth to the screen's contents internally through use of a parallax barrier ; or, as the console's marketing puts it, provides "3D graphics without needing special glasses ". In addition to its own library of games, the system is backwards compatible with almost all Nintendo DS games and with the enhancements previously unique to the Nintendo DSi. It is the direct successor to the Nintendo DS line. Despite its name, it is intended to be an entirely different line of systems from the DS line. Its main feature is its stereoscopic 3D capability, which provides a three dimensional effect providing depth rather than having everything "come at the viewer". It is also unnecessary to use 3D glasses to experience the 3D effect. Also unique to the system is its gyroscope, which allows for certain games to have their cameras manipulated without pressing buttons.

Fire Emblem is a series of tactical role-playing video games developed by Intelligent Systems and published by Nintendo. Its first game released in Japan in , and is credited with both originating and popularizing its genre. GBA games are currently only available to "Ambassadors", people who purchased the 3DS prior to the price cut only a few months after the system's launch. Until recently, the NES games were also Ambassador-exclusives, but Nintendo is currently gradually allowing the games to be made available to the general public. All Ambassadors receive the games free of charge as compensation for the price cut, while everyone else will need to purchase the games. For the first month of the 3DS's existence, 3D Classics: ExciteBike , a three dimensional remake of the classic NES motocross title, was free of charge to all customers.
